ae怎么制作小球页面加载动效?

对于怎么制作小球页面加载动效,实际上可以使用 ae 动画软件制作,具体步骤如下:

步骤一:新建一个 ae 项目,并导入素材

首先,我们新建一个 ae 项目,选择一个合适的分辨率(如 1920 * 1080),然后需要导入素材,可以使用 ae 自带的素材库,也可以选择自己准备的素材,或者通过网络下载一些素材。

步骤二:制作小球动画

接下来,我们需要制作小球动画,可以采取以下步骤:

  1. ae 的面板中拖入一个 Null Object,然后再拖入一个 Shape Layer,用于作为绘制小球的工具。通过 Pen Tool 工具绘制一个球体,可以调整球体颜色、线宽等相关属性。

  2. 随后,我们需要将球体绑定到 Null Object 上面,这样可以方便我们对小球进行平移、旋转等操作。选择球体图层,然后点击上方的 Parent 按钮,选择 Null Object,即可完成绑定操作。

  3. 接下来,我们需要制作小球的动画,比如从右侧屏幕外缓缓移入,可以通过 Position 参数进行设置,并使用关键帧来控制其运动轨迹。

    ```markdown
    示例一:小球从右侧屏幕外缓缓移入

    1. 首先,在时间轴的 0s 处设置小球的初始位置,比如在屏幕右侧外面。然后,单击小球图层旁边的小钟图标,即可添加一个关键帧。

    2. 接下来,在时间轴的 2s 处,设置小球的最终位置,比如在屏幕中央,然后再次单击小球旁边的小钟图标,此时可以看到两个关键帧之间有一个缓动的动画,表现为小球在屏幕上缓缓移动的状态。

    3. 最后,导出动画或者生成视频即可。
      ```

  4. 还可以对小球添加一些其他的动画效果,比如弹跳、旋转等,方法类似,使用不同的参数进行设置即可。

    ```markdown
    示例二:小球弹跳效果

    1. 在时间轴的 0s 处,设置小球的初始位置。

    2. 单击小球旁边的小钟图标,然后将 Position 参数设置为 0, 0。

    3. 在时间轴的 1s 处,设置小球弹跳的最高点,此时需要调整 Position 参数,使小球向上弹到一个合适的高度。

    4. 在时间轴的 2s 处,设置小球落地的位置,即 Position 参数设置为屏幕中央。

    5. 单击 Rotation 参数旁边的小钟图标,添加两个关键帧,然后分别设置小球在起始状态和地面状态的旋转角度。

    6. 导出动画或者生成视频即可。

    ```

步骤三:应用小球动画到页面加载效果中

最后,我们需要将小球动画应用到页面加载效果中,这一步可以通过 HTMLCSSJavaScript 来实现。

  1. 首先,在 HTML 页面中创建指示页面加载状态的元素,比如 div 标签。

  2. 然后,在 CSS 样式中设置加载状态元素的相关样式,比如颜色、大小、位置等,同时需要设置其 z-index 值为最高,以保持在窗口最上方。

    css
    .loading {
    position: fixed;
    top: 0;
    left: 0;
    width: 100%;
    height: 100%;
    background-color: #ffffff;
    z-index: 9999;
    }

  3. 接下来,在 JavaScript 中使用 window.onload 事件监听页面加载完成事件,一旦页面加载完成,即可隐藏加载状态元素。

    javascript
    window.addEventListener('load', function () {
    document.querySelector('.loading').style.display = 'none';
    })

  4. 最后,将制作好的小球动画应用到加载状态元素上,实现页面加载效果。

    html
    <div class="loading">
    // 将制作好的小球动画效果嵌入到此处
    </div>

通过以上步骤,我们即可轻松地实现小球页面加载动效,通过 ae 制作小球动画,再将其应用到页面加载效果中即可。编写的代码和实现的效果都可以在浏览器中进行预览和调试。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:ae怎么制作小球页面加载动效? - Python技术站

(0)
上一篇 2023年6月25日
下一篇 2023年6月25日

相关文章

  • 岳麓山风景名胜区-景点介绍

    岳麓山风景名胜区-景点介绍攻略 岳麓山风景名胜区位于湖南省长沙市岳麓区,是中国著名的风景区之一。本文将详细介绍岳麓山风景名胜区的景点介绍,包含两个示例说明。 1. 景点介绍 1.1. 橘子洲头 橘子洲头位于岳麓山风景名胜区的湖岸边,是长沙市的标志性景点之一。这里有美丽的湖景和独特的文化氛围,游客拍照和休闲的好去处。 1.2. 岳麓书院 岳麓书院是中国历史上著…

    other 2023年5月9日
    00
  • 如何在iOS中高效的加载图片详解

    如何在iOS中高效的加载图片详解 为什么需要高效加载图片? 在iOS应用中,我们通常会使用图片作为应用的重要元素。然而,加载图片是一个很耗费时间和资源的过程。如果不进行优化,可能会导致应用性能下降,出现卡顿或者卡死等问题。因此,我们需要使用一些技巧和工具来高效地加载图片。 高效加载图片的技巧 1. 图片压缩 对于超过屏幕显示大小的图片,我们需要进行压缩处理。…

    other 2023年6月25日
    00
  • IDEA配置jdk环境变量的方法

    下面是“IDEA配置jdk环境变量的方法”的完整攻略: 1. 下载和安装JDK 首先需要下载和安装JDK,这里以JDK 11为例子进行讲解,具体步骤如下: 访问JDK官方网站(https://www.oracle.com/java/technologies/javase-jdk11-downloads.html),下载对应操作系统版本的JDK 11安装包; …

    other 2023年6月27日
    00
  • 简易jquery插件

    当然,我可以为您提供详细的“简易jQuery插件”的完整攻略,包括两个示例说明。 简易jQuery插件的完整攻略 jQuery是一个流行的JavaScript库,它提供了许多实用的功能和方法,可以简化JavaScript编程。jQuery插件是一种扩展jQuery功能方式,可以我们轻松地添加自定义功能和效果。在本教程中,我们将介绍如何编写一个简易的jQuer…

    other 2023年5月7日
    00
  • Java实现复原IP地址的方法

    Java实现复原IP地址的方法 复原IP地址是指将一个字符串转换为合法的IP地址。在Java中,可以使用递归和回溯的方法来实现这个功能。下面是一个完整的攻略,包含了详细的步骤和两个示例说明。 步骤 定义一个函数restoreIpAddresses,该函数接受一个字符串作为输入,并返回所有可能的合法IP地址。 在restoreIpAddresses函数中,创建…

    other 2023年7月31日
    00
  • Python基础教程之名称空间以及作用域

    Python基础教程之名称空间以及作用域攻略 名称空间(Namespace) 在Python中,名称空间是一个存储变量和函数名称的地方。它们用于区分不同的变量、函数和其他对象,以便在代码中引用它们。Python中有三种类型的名称空间:内置名称空间、全局名称空间和局部名称空间。 内置名称空间(Built-in Namespace) 内置名称空间包含了Pytho…

    other 2023年8月8日
    00
  • 魔兽世界7.2.5邪DK怎么堆属性 wow7.25邪DK属性优先级攻略

    魔兽世界7.2.5邪DK怎么堆属性 1. 邪DK属性优先级 邪恶力量(Mastery)> 全能(Versatility)> 暴击(Critical Strike)> 急速(Haste) 2. 套装选择 邪恶力量为邪DK的最大输出属性,因此需要选择巨神殿的套装,在满足邪恶力量达到35%的前提下,尽可能地增加全能属性。 3. 宝石镶嵌 首先,宝…

    other 2023年6月27日
    00
  • 微信小程序自定义导航教程(兼容各种手机)

    我将详细讲解“微信小程序自定义导航教程(兼容各种手机)”的完整攻略。 一、背景介绍 在微信小程序中,我们经常需要使用自定义导航栏来实现更加个性化的界面效果。然而,不同型号的手机在导航栏高度、胶囊按钮大小和位置等方面都存在差异,因此需要我们设计合理的方案来兼容各种手机。 二、方案设计 1. 设置全局样式: 我们可以在app.wxss文件中设置全局样式,包括导航…

    other 2023年6月25日
    00
合作推广
合作推广
分享本页
返回顶部